Hydrangeas are among the most popular flowering shrubs, with over 75 species worldwide. Known for their vibrant blooms and lush foliage, hydrangeas are a versatile choice for enhancing any landscape. When it comes to hydrangea planting, understanding the specific needs of these plants is crucial. They thrive in well-drained soil and require a balance of sun and shade to flourish. With careful consideration of soil acidity, hydrangeas can produce a stunning array of colors, from vivid blues to soft pinks. This adaptability makes them a favorite for gardeners looking to add a splash of color and texture to their outdoor spaces. Proper planting and maintenance ensure that hydrangeas become a long-lasting, beautiful addition to any garden.
Benefits of Hydrangea Planting
- Visual Appeal: Hydrangeas offer an array of colors that can brighten any landscape. Their large, showy blooms create a stunning visual impact that can elevate the aesthetic of your outdoor space.
- Low Maintenance: Once established, hydrangeas require minimal care, making them an ideal choice for busy homeowners. Regular watering and occasional pruning are often enough to keep them thriving.
- Environmental Benefits: These plants contribute to a healthier ecosystem by providing habitat and food for pollinators like bees and butterflies. They also help improve air quality by absorbing carbon dioxide.
- Versatility: Hydrangeas can be planted in a variety of settings, from garden borders to container plants. Their adaptability allows them to complement different landscape designs and personal styles.
